COPYWRITING Lessons Learned While Writing Copy
Bob Cargill, L.W. Robbins Associates
According to Bob, writing copy for a living is like being a student all of your life in the school of hard knocks. In this seminar, hell tell what hes learned about copywriting from creative people, account people, clients and customers. Hell share with you a few interesting anecdotes and a lot of great examples of how experienced copywriters solve their own direct marketing problems. Hell also introduce a number of strategies and principles used to trigger a favorable response and win awards for creativity.
Attend this workshop and youre guaranteed to:
" Learn the difference between writing copy
to generate leads, sales and charitable contributions.
" Learn the definition of verisimilitude and how to use it to your advantage.
" Learn how to borrow from pop culture and current events to strengthen your copy.
With more than 19 years of experience in the direct marketing industry as a copywriter and creative director, Bobs work has been recognized with over two dozen awards, including Best of Show honors at the New England Direct Marketing Association Shoestring awards ceremony. Bob is an instructor of the Principles of Copywriting, From Direct Mail to E-Mail for the Bentley College Information Age Marketing program and is a frequent speaker and authority on the subject of copywriting and direct marketing.

CREATIVE Profiting From Your Creativity  Bill McDonough, The Idea Guys Creativity cant be left to the creative department. Responsibility for generating the ideas and solving the problems that enable a business to compete and prosper must be shared across the organization. Every single executive, manager and employee can, and must, be encouraged to break out of their mental cubicle and use innovative thinking to confront challenges and create opportunities.
Attend this workshop and youre guaranteed to:
" Learn the 2 principles underlying true creativity
" Learn tips, tools and techniques for immediately stimulating your creativity
" See flying snack foods
The Idea Guys have sounded the call for creativity at organizations such as ABC-TV, Stratus, Tufts Health Plan and Sun Life of Canada. When hes not hosting jazz radio programs or writing his monthly column for Jazziz magazine, Bill McDonough can be found at his keyboard, solving marketing puzzles.
